The role
Maintain production equipment on the 2nd shift to maximize uptime in a food manufacturing environment.
Perform preventive maintenance and repair electrical and mechanical systems on production lines.
Troubleshoot issues, restore equipment to operation, and document maintenance activities.
Train machine operators on safe operation, basic maintenance tasks, and quality procedures.
Conduct routine inspections to ensure compliance with safety and food safety standards.
This role requires a strong industrial maintenance background with tool proficiency and safety certifications; salary ranges from $55,000 to $62,000 USD.
